EMPHATIC DENIAL
NEGOTIATIONS FOR TIMOR (Received October 12. 2 p.m.) LONDON, October 12 The Japanese Embassy emphatically denies that Japan contemplated purchasing a portion of Timor, or offered in tile past to buy the Australian mandate of New Guinea.
